Dell XPS 13 and Dell Inspiron 14 Plus were launched in India as the first Copilot+ PCs by the company on Tuesday (July 16). The refreshed laptops are equipped with the Snapdragon X series chipsets that come with a dedicated neural processing unit (NPU) offering up to 45 trillion operations per second (TOPS).
